Amazon, Warner Bros. Licensing Deal Brings More TV Shows To Prime Instant Video

0

Amazon today announced
that it has struck a licensing deal with Warner Bros. Domestic
Television Distribution to bring more TV shows to its Prime Instant
Video catalog. Among these new shows are The West Wing, Fringe, Dark Blue, Alcatraz and The Whole Truth. According to Amazon, both Fringe and The West Wing
will be available exclusively on Prime Instant Video for the summer. In
total, Amazon’s subscription video streaming service now feature about
18,000 movies and TV episodes. With Amazon Instant Video, the company
also features about 120,000 titles that users can purchase or rent.

Prime Instant Video is mostly meant as an extra perk for subscribers
to Amazon’s $79/year two-day shipping service. In addition to “free”
access to the streaming video library, users also get to borrow books
for their Kindle devices.
